Brad Stevens and the Boston Celtics were active on Day 2 of the 2025 NBA Draft.
After selecting Spanish guard Hugo Gonzalez with the 28th overall pick on Day 1, the Celtics traded their No. 32 pick to the Orlando Magic for picks 46 and 57, as well as two future second-rounders. They used the No. 46 pick to select Kentucky center Amari Williams and the No. 57 pick to take VCU guard Max Shulga.
